10. Do not forsake your own friend or your father's friend, And do not go to your brother's house in the day of your calamity; Better is a neighbor who is near than a brother far away.
11. Be wise, my son, and make my heart glad, That I may reply to him who reproaches me.
12. A prudent man sees evil and hides himself, The naive proceed and pay the penalty.
13. Take his garment when he becomes surety for a stranger; And for an adulterous woman hold him in pledge.
